City of Pennsboro (Owner) is requesting Bids for the construction of the following Project: Phase II Water System Improvements Project The Project includes the following Work: Replacement of approximately 20,300 LF of 2", 6", and 8" water line, approximately 205 water meter replacements, 20 Fire Hydrant Assemblies, approximately 60 gate valves, and all other necessary appurtenances necessary for a water line replacement project. Bids are requested for the following Contract: Phase II Water System Improvements Project The Work will be substantially completed within 365 calendar days after the date when the Contract Times commence to run, and completed and ready for final payment within 395 days after the date when the Contract Times commence to run. Amounts paid are not subject to refund. A two envelope system will be used. Envelope No. 1 must have the following information presented on the front: Name and address of Bidder Bid on Contract - Phase II Water System Improvements Project Received by the City of Pennsboro Envelope No. 2 labeled "Bid Proposal" shall also be placed inside of Envelope #1. Envelope No. 1 will be opened first and the Bid Opening Requirement items checked for compliance as outlined on the Bid Opening Checklist on page BOR - 1 of these contract documents. If such documents are found to be in order, Envelope No. 2 "Bid Proposal", will then be opened and will be publicly read aloud. If the documents required to be contained in Envelope No. 1 are not in order, Envelope No. 2 "Bid Proposal" will not be opened and the Bid will be considered non-responsive and will be returned to the Bidder. DBE Requirements - Each Bidder must fully Comply with the Disadvantaged Business Enterprises, and Affirmative Action Requirements, as identified in the contract documents. A bidder may not withdraw his bid for a period of ninety (90) days after the date set for the opening of bids. Bids shall be accompanied by a certified check or bid bond payable to City of Pennsboro in an amount equal to five percent (5%) of the base bid.
